Victims of fatal Highway 11 crash in Temagami identified

Two people were killed in the three-vehicle collision that involved a transport

Members of the Temiskaming Detachment of the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) have identified the two deceased involved in the fatal motor vehicle collision that occurred on Highway 11 in the Municipality of Temagami shortly after 6:30 p.m. on December 8, 2021.    

Further investigation revealed that a Commercial Motor Vehicle (CMV) was southbound and two passenger vehicles were northbound when the collision occurred.

The driver and passenger of the first vehicle were located deceased in the vehicle and have been identified as 60-year-old William Parton from the City of Brantford and 66-year-old Sandra Moyer from the Community of Ayr.

The driver and passenger of the CMV, along with the driver of the second vehicle, sustained non-life threatening injuries.

The OPP's Technical Traffic Collision Investigators (TTCI) and the Office of the Chief Coroner- Ontario Forensic Pathology Service (OCC-FPS) are assisting with this investigation.
